How much do business process automation analyst j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 16, 2026, the average yearly pay for business process automation analyst in Delaware is $71,317.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$57,900.00 and $74,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Business Process Automation Analyst?

A Business Process Automation Analyst is a professional who evaluates, designs, and implements technology solutions to streamline and optimize business processes. They work closely with different departments to identify repetitive tasks that can be automated, reducing manual work and improving efficiency. Their responsibilities often include analyzing workflow, selecting appropriate automation tools, developing process documentation, and monitoring the outcomes to ensure continual improvement. This role typically requires strong analytical skills, knowledge of automation platforms, and an understanding of business operations.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Business Process Automation Anal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Business Process Automation Analyst, you need strong analytical skills, knowledge of business process modeling, and a background in information systems or a related field. Familiarity with tools like RPA platforms (e.g., UiPath, Automation Anywhere), workflow management systems, and relevant certifications such as Lean Six Sigma or BPMN are highly valued. Excellent problem-solving abilities, communication skills, and a collaborative mindset help analysts effectively identify automation opportunities and drive change across teams. These skills are crucial for streamlining operations, improving efficiency, and ensuring successful implementation of automation solutions within organizations.

What is the difference between Business Process Automation Analyst vs Business Systems Analyst?

AspectBusiness Process Automation AnalystBusiness Systems Analyst
Required CredentialsCertifications in BPM tools, process modeling, and automation platformsCertifications in systems analysis, project management, and business analysis
Work EnvironmentFocus on automation projects, process improvement teamsWork with IT and business units to analyze and improve systems
Employer & Industry UsageUsed in industries emphasizing automation and efficiencyCommon across various industries for system and process analysis
Search & Comparison IntentOften compared for automation skills and process optimizationCompared for broader system analysis and business requirements gathering

The Business Process Automation Analyst specializes in automating and optimizing business processes using specific automation tools, while the Business Systems Analyst focuses on analyzing and improving overall business systems and requirements. Both roles require analytical skills and industry experience but differ in their primary focus and tools used.

What are some common challenges faced by Business Process Automation Analysts when implementing new automation solutions?

Business Process Automation Analysts often encounter challenges such as resistance to change from stakeholders, integrating new automation tools with legacy systems, and ensuring that automated processes align with business objectives. Effective communication and change management skills are essential when educating team members about new workflows. Additionally, analysts must balance the need for efficiency with maintaining proper controls and compliance standards.
